    Cauliflower (Brassica oleracea var. botrytis) is a versatile cruciferous vegetable known for its compact, white head of undeveloped flowers. Here's a product description:


    1. **Appearance:**

       - Cauliflower typically features a dense, round head (curd) composed of tightly packed, creamy-white florets. However, there are colorful varieties with hues like orange, green, and purple.


    2. **Flavor and Texture:**

       - Mild and slightly sweet flavor, making it adaptable to various cooking methods.

    3  *Nutritional Content:**

       - Low in calories but rich in essential nutrients like vitamin C, vitamin K, and fiber.

       - Contains antioxidants that may offer various health benefits.


    4. **Culinary Uses:**

       - Cauliflower is a versatile ingredient used in both raw and cooked forms.

       - Commonly used as a low-carb substitute for rice, mashed potatoes, or in gluten-free pizza crusts.

       - Roasting, steaming, sautéing, or boiling are popular cooking methods.


    5. **Varieties:**

       - Apart from the traditional white cauliflower, there are colorful varieties like orange, green (Romanesco), and purple, each offering unique flavors and nutritional profiles.


    6. **Health Benefits:**

       - Cauliflower is part of a healthy diet, contributing to digestive health, immune support, and bone health.

       - Its antioxidants may have anti-inflammatory properties.


    7. **Cultural Significance:**

       - Used in a variety of cuisines globally, cauliflower is appreciated for its ability to absorb flavors and adapt to diverse culinary styles.


    8. **Trends and Innovations:**

       - Cauliflower has gained popularity in recent years as a versatile ingredient in plant-based and low-carb diets.

       - Innovations include cauliflower-based products like rice, pizza crusts, and snacks.


    In summary, cauliflower is a nutritious and adaptable vegetable widely used in cooking due to its mild flavor and versatility. Its ability to take on various forms and flavors makes it a staple in many kitchens.
